Design Concept
The first step was to deconstruct the cocoa bean structure… The result was an inspiration of layering color, texture, and materials starting from the exterior facade into the interior, with the kitchen metaphorically acting as the core.
Entrance Attraction: The entrance of the shop is designed to make an inviting first impression. The pink and green walls create a striking contrast. The facade of the chocolate shop reflects the exterior of a cocoa bean.
Open floor Plan: Adopting an open floor plan encourages exploration and encourages customers to linger. Wide aisles allow for easy navigation, ensuring that no corner of the store goes unnoticed. Customers can easily navigate through different sections, such as chocolate displays and seating.
Layout
Chocolate Counter: At the heart of the shop stands the stylish chocolate counter, featuring natural wood bars and a sleek marble countertop. Rows of vibrantly colored chocolates are artfully displayed, and from exotic animal-shaped chocolates to vehicles, the selection is endless. The tempered glass showcase is low enough for customers to see and choose their favorites with ease.
Display Shelf: In order to accommodate packages of different colors, the shelves are designed on the wall, which not only maximizes the storage space, but also makes the display look orderly.
Display Showcase: The main material of display showcases is tempered glass because of its high-quality, scratch-resistant. It will not only protect the delicate chocolates but also ensure that their rich colors and intricate designs are showcased to perfection. Custom-made displays shaped like cocoa pods or chocolate bars can be eye-catching.
Seating Area: Seating snakes around the perimeter while bubble gum-hued counter stools invite visitors to observe the chocolate-making process and, perhaps, snag a taste or two. Choose pink chairs that complement the overall color scheme. Consider using pink strips as accents to add visual interest. Include cozy seating arrangements with warm lighting so that customers can enjoy their treats in the seating area.
Lighting: Use soft, warm lighting to create a cozy ambiance. Pendant lights with a pink hue or chandeliers with a whimsical design can enhance the theme.
